Select the correct option: Their approach proved ___ effective that competitors quickly emulated it.
so
The sentence uses a result clause introduced by "that" ("effective that competitors quickly emulated it"), which requires the correlative pair "so...that" to express cause and result.
"So" fits before the adjective "effective" to set up the result clause that follows, forming the standard "so + adjective + that" structure.
"Too" pairs with "to" rather than "that" to show an excessive degree preventing an action, "as" is used in comparisons of equality, and "very" does not take a following "that" clause of result, so none of these fit the given sentence structure.
Hence, the answer is so.
